Output e640f44e6429e55b13b5edb202e344148fd6c38ef0860b516ec0d0738a690406:0

value
547587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e331af61a0a271563363f961bc0a08d8fc8c7005 OP_EQUALVERIFY OP_CHECKSIG
address
1MiHuj5zfkDpE5FygcTQzbaAuRiYbzrubU
transaction
e640f44e6429e55b13b5edb202e344148fd6c38ef0860b516ec0d0738a690406
spent
true